The speed of light in the Seventeenth General Conference on Weights and Measures (October 1983) to maintain unchanged the value of the speed of light recommended in 1975 by the Fifteenth General Conference on Weights and Measures in its Resolution 2, c = 299,792,458 m/s

In fact, it is an accepted weighted average value, determined from three measurements :

Translated (p 68 15th CGPM) :

Considering, on the other hand, the needs in the fields of astronomy, geodesy, and geophysics, the C.C.D.M. decided to recommend a value for c.

The three recent measurements leading to precise values for the speed of light in a vacuum and discussed by the C.C.D.M. are:

1° The measurement of the frequency of the methane-tuned laser with its wavelength value already recommended, which gives

c = (299,792,458.3 +/- 1.2) m/s

2° The measurement of the frequency of the R(12) line of carbon dioxide with its wavelength determined, which gives

c = (299,792,457 +/- 6) m/s

3° Bay el Luther's measurement, which uses microwave modulation of the visible radiation of a helium-neon laser and gives

c = (299,792,462 +/- 18) m/s

Due to the significant difference in uncertainties, which are 4.10^9, 2.10^-8 and 6 x 10^8 in relative terms, only the first of the three results is important for determining the weighted average value, which is

c = 299,792,458 m/s
